Off-Pump Minithoracotomy Versus Sternotomy for Left Anterior Descending Myocardial Bridge Unroofing

Summary
Minimally invasive myocardial bridge (MB) unroofing offers a safe and effective surgical option for symptomatic patients. This approach significantly improves angina symptoms and quality of life compared to traditional sternotomy methods.
Area of Science:
- Cardiovascular Surgery
- Thoracic Surgery
- Minimally Invasive Surgery
Background:
- Myocardial bridge (MB) of the left anterior descending (LAD) coronary artery affects approximately 25% of the population.
- Surgical MB unroofing is optimal when medical therapy fails for symptomatic, hemodynamically significant MB.
- This study compares minimally invasive MB unroofing with sternotomy in selected patients.
Purpose of the Study:
- To evaluate the safety and efficacy of minimally invasive MB unroofing.
- To compare outcomes of minithoracotomy off-pump (MT) MB unroofing with sternotomy on-pump (ST-on) and sternotomy off-pump (ST-off) approaches.
- To assess symptomatic improvement and quality of life post-procedure.
Main Methods:
- 141 adult patients underwent MB unroofing via sternotomy on-pump (n=40), sternotomy off-pump (n=62), or minithoracotomy off-pump (n=39).
- Seattle Angina Questionnaire assessed angina symptoms preoperatively and 6 months postoperatively.
- Matching was performed for MT patients and a subset of ST-off patients based on MB characteristics and prior interventions.
Main Results:
- Minithoracotomy off-pump (MT) patients had shorter hospital stays (3.0 days) compared to sternotomy off-pump (ST-off) patients (4.0 days) after matching (P=.005).
- ST-on patients experienced longer hospital stays (5.0 days) and more blood transfusions (15.2%) than ST-off and MT groups (P<.001, P=.002).
- No deaths or major complications were observed in any group; all groups showed significant symptomatic improvement.
Conclusions:
- Off-pump minimally invasive MB unroofing can be safely performed in carefully selected patients.
- This approach leads to dramatic improvements in angina symptoms at 6 months post-operation.
- Minimally invasive surgery offers a viable alternative to sternotomy for MB unroofing.
